Calcified Coronary Artery Disease Clinical Trial
Official title:
Super High-Pressure Balloon Versus Intravascular Lithotripsy for Severely Calcified Coronary Lesions: The ComparIson of Strategies to PrepAre SeveRely CALCified Coronary Lesions (ISAR-CALC) 2 Randomized Trial
The ISAR-CALC 2 trial is an investigator-initiated, prospective, randomized, multicenter, assessors-blind, open-label other clinical investigation. The objective of this trial is to investigate final angiographic minimal lumen diameter (MLD) following a strategy of super high-pressure balloon (OPN NC) versus intravascular lithotripsy (IVL) for drug-eluting stent (DES) implantation in severely calcified coronary lesions.
